Awards Received

  • Distinguished Service Cross

    Service:

    United States Army

    Rank:

    Sergeant

    Regiment:

    6th Cavalry

    Action Date:

    July 4, 1909

    War Department, General Orders No. 14 (1925)

    The President of the United States of America, authorized by Act of Congress, July 9, 1918, takes pleasure in presenting the Distinguished Service Cross to Sergeant William Wendell, United States Army, for extraordinary heroism while serving with Troop C, 6th Cavalry, in action against hostile Moros on Patian Island, Philippine Islands, 4 July 1909. Sergeant Wendell with other men entered a cave occupied by a desperate enemy and in the face of a heavy fire, with utter disregard for his personal safety, aided in forcing the outlaws to abandon their stronghold, which resulted in their destruction by our forces.
